The last 30 games hitting stats are truly horrific
Some low lights:
Bader is hitting .138 with 17 SO’s in 58 AB’s 1 RBI
Goldschmidt hitting .190 with 28 SO’s in 84 AB’s 10 RBI
Carpenter is hitting .204 with 17 SO’s in 54 AB’s 6 RBI
DeJong is hitting .228 with 21 SO’s in 92 AB’s 8 RBIbest hitters in that 30 game period are:
Fowler is hitting. .269 15 SO’s in 67 AB’s 16RBI
Wong is hitting .265 with 8 SO’s in 68 AB’s 7 RBI
Munoz is hitting .355 with 3 SO’s in 31 AB’s 5 RBI
Edman is hitting .278 with 10 SO’s in 54 AB’s 9 RBI
Martinez is hitting 267 With 16 SO’s in 75 AB’s 8 RBI1 run in last 16 innings….offense is a joke
